What's in the News
- The Board of Directors authorized a new share buyback plan of up to $75 million, valid until January 31, 2027; 1,799,571 shares (2.74%) have already been repurchased for $48.81 million under a previous plan.
- A quarterly dividend of $0.15 per share was declared.
- Earnings guidance for Q3 2025 projects operating income of $46.8–$48.8 million and EPS of $0.55–$0.57; full-year 2025 guidance sets operating income at $187.8–$193.8 million and EPS at $2.29–$2.36.
- The company was dropped from the Russell 3000E, Russell 3000E Value, Russell Microcap, and Russell Microcap Value Indexes.
Valuation Changes
Summary of Valuation Changes for Perdoceo Education
- The Consensus Analyst Price Target has risen slightly from $40.00 to $42.00.
- The Future P/E for Perdoceo Education has risen from 16.89x to 17.75x.
- The Discount Rate for Perdoceo Education remained effectively unchanged, moving only marginally from 7.02% to 7.04%.
